I have a dvd movie that is scratched and am trying to make a backup using DVD X Rescue. It gets to a certain point and the time keeps increasing but not moving any further in the process. Does this mean that it will not rescue this dvd?

You can also try this.

Once Xrescue is open, click on file>preferences and put a check on the box next to "Accept read errors during copy"

Try analyzing the disk before trying to rescue it.
Try and perform a readability test, be certain and select the moderate scan option
